What does an LED Mask do for the skin?

An LED skin mask is used to treat various skin problems and improve skin condition. The mask emits different wavelengths of light, such as red, blue and yellow light, each of which provides specific benefits to the skin:

  1. Red light & NIR: Stimulates collagen production, reduces inflammation & redness, promotes skin healing and reduces fine lines and wrinkles.
  2. Blue light: Kills bacteria that cause acne, reduces inflammation and helps reduce acne breakouts.
  3. Yellow Light: Improves blood flow, reduces redness and inflammation, and promotes an even complexion.

Overall, regular use of an LED mask can improve overall skin condition, reduce acne, even out complexion, refine skin texture and reduce signs of aging.

LED Masks - A worthwhile investment or a waste?

If the wavelength is wrong or the irradiance is too low, your LED mask could be a complete disappointment. To get value for money, here's what to look out for:

1. Wavelength

Check for the following values:

  • Red light: 630 nm
  • Infrared (NIR): 850 nm
  • Blue light: 460 nm
  • Green light: 530 nm

2. Radiance

The amount of light falling on the surface (measured in mw/cm2). The optimal values are between 40-150 mw/cm2.
Ideally, the radiation should be lower than 50 because then you are less likely to overheat the skin.

3. Dose

This indicates the energy delivered per unit area, which should be sufficient. The dose depends on how strong the radiation is and how long the treatment takes. Higher irradiance helps reduce the treatment time; the minimum irradiation time is usually 2 minutes.

4. Quality assurance

Buy a mask that is CEand/or FDA approved for quality assurance.

Why can't you use too much blue light?

  • First, let's discuss why you should be careful with blue light.
  • Blue light has convincing results against acne thanks to its bactericidal properties.
  • However, it carries a risk of hyperpigmentation, which is why it is usually recommended for use for up to 6 weeks. In addition, prolonged exposure to blue light can strip the skin of its natural oils, leading to dryness and worsening existing skin problems, such as eczema or dermatitis.
  • Interestingly, red light and NIR also have a positive impact on acne because of their anti-inflammatory effects.
  • Therefore, choosing LED masks with customizable settings that include red and near-infrared light in addition to blue light can help maximize the effectiveness of LED therapy while protecting your skin.
